We have been active in creating websites already for some years, but recently we started also with web-based software.
So we started to look for partners to sale our production around the world.

One partner company is interested in selling our products, but we can't agree in %, we would give them for sales.
We offer them about 20%, they want around 50%.

our responsibilities and expneces: all that is needed to create new software - software, hardware, expences on programmers, design, etc.

partner's responsibilities: selling our products, promoting and advertising us in their region.

so what do u think, folks, what should the proper % be?

The question boils down to how much would the partner be investing? What are the advertising costs, employee costs, etc.?

If those figures equal your expenses, then 50% would be adequate. However, their expenses could be higher than yours.

However, I have found that 25% is more than adequate for a sales commission in this type of format.

As a note, I pay my PR Firm 25% on each sale. Anyone that wants more than that is off bounds.
